01-第一章 Qt开发环境_第1页
01-第一章 Qt开发环境_第2页
01-第一章 Qt开发环境_第3页
01-第一章 Qt开发环境_第4页
01-第一章 Qt开发环境_第5页
已阅读5页,还剩16页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

——基于Qt(Windows)版医用仪器软件设计MedicalInstrumentSoftwareDesign2022绪论——BasedonQt(WindowsEdition)2022课程介绍覃进宇关于这门课Aboutthiscourse.“目前QtCreator的操作系统比以往的更加强大,想要掌握其知识点,必须花费大量的时间和精力来熟悉Qt的开发环境构建套件、版本更新与版本兼容等。为了减轻初学者查找资料和熟悉开发工具的负担,以使初学者将更多的精力聚焦在实践环节并快速入门,本书将每个实验涉及的知识点汇总在“实验原理”中,将Qt开发环境常见类与控件等的使用方法穿插于各章节中。这样读者就可以通过本书轻松踏上学习Qt开发之路,在实践过程中不知不觉地掌握各种知识和技能。One

课程介绍Coursecontent串口通信人体生理参数监测系统GUI程序五参:体温、血压、呼吸、血氧和心电课前准备Beforeclass…#软件QtCreatorNotepad++#资料百度网盘:/s/1xEZdl-kidlspzG3s2YFKtw提取码:q9vf教材配套资料关于这本书Aboutthisbook.“本书主要结合医疗电子技术领域的应用来介绍Qt应用程序的开发设计,内容条理清晰,首先引导读者学习Qt开发使用的C++语言,然后结合实验对Qt的基础知识展开介绍,最后通过进阶实验使读者的水平进一步提高。让读者循序渐进行地学习Qt知识,即使是未接触过程序设计的初学者也可以快速上手。Two

章节目录TableofcontentsQt开发环境Qt的类与控件C++语言基础面向对象程序设计Qt程序设计打包解包小工具设计实验串口通信小工具设计实验波形处理小工具设计实验人体生理参数监测系统软件平台体温监测与显示实验血压监测与显示实验呼吸监测与显示实验血氧监测与显示实验心电监测与显示实验数据存储实验实验内容:简要介绍本章内容,明确学习目标。实验原理:详述完成所需的理论基础。读者在阅读实验原理部分后,既可独立完成本章实验。实验步骤与代码解析:介绍实验的程序设计思路,详述每一行代码的作用。本章任务:每章实验都会有对应的本章任务,是例程的延伸,源于例程而又高于例程,考验读者对编程语言以及各章知识的掌握程度。本章习题:与本章实验原理有关的简答题,帮助读者巩固理论知识。内容划分Content——基于Qt(Windows)版医用仪器软件设计MedicalInstrumentSoftwareDesign2022第1章Qt开发环境——BasedonQt(WindowsEdition)目录Qt概述搭建Qt开发环境Qt开发环境介绍第一个Qt项目本章任务本章习题Qt概述Qt是一个跨平台的、基于C++的图形用户界面应用程序开发框架。Qt开发框架:包括一套跨平台的类库、一套整合的开发工具和一个跨平台的集成开发环境(IDE)。跨平台:只需编写一次程序,在经过少许改动甚至无需改动的情况下,就可以形成在不同平台上运行的版本,为开发者提供了极大的便利。可以开发GUI程序,也可开发非GUI程序,例如控制台工具和服务器。是面向对象的,易扩展,并且允许真正的组件编程。支持多种平台,包括Windows、Linux/Unix和MacOS等PC和服务器平台,还有Android、iOS、EmbeddedLinux和WinRT等移动和嵌入式操作系统。与MFC、GTK等是类似的开发工具,但Qt优秀的跨平台特性、丰富的API接口、详尽的开发技术手册等是其他开发工具无法比拟的。搭建Qt开发环境具体搭建步骤可参照书本1.2节,过程如下:安装Qt配置构建套件Qt开发环境介绍菜单栏模式选择栏构建套件选择器定位器输出窗口菜单栏1.菜单栏菜单栏共有8个菜单选项。文件菜单:包含新建、打开和关闭项目的功能。编辑菜单:包含撤销、剪切、复制、粘贴、查找和替换等基本功能。构建菜单:包含构建和运行项目相关的功能。调试菜单:包含与程序调试相关的功能。Analyze菜单:包含QML分析器、Valgrind内存和功能分析器等。工具菜单:包含快速定位、选项设置等功能,在选项设置中可以配置构建套件,进行环境设置、文本编辑器设置、构建和运行设置、调试器设置等。帮助菜单:包含目录、索引、Qt版本信息和bug报告等。控件菜单:包含设置窗口布局的一些功能。2.模式选择栏6种模式:欢迎、编辑、设计、Debug、项目和帮助。启动Qt后的第一个界面就是欢迎模式的界面,在欢迎模式下有3大功能类别:Projects、示例和教程。编辑模式:主要用于管理项目文件、查看和编辑程序代码。设计模式:用于进行图形界面设计。Debug模式:查看调试断点和函数情况。项目模式:包含对项目的构建设置、运行设置、编辑器设置、代码风格设置等内容。帮助模式:查看QtCreator的各方面信息。模式选择栏3.构建套件选择器构建套件选择器包含目标选择器、运行按钮、调试按钮和构建按钮4个部分。目标选择器:用于选择待构建的项目和使用的构建模式(Debug、Profile和Release)运行按钮:实现项目的构建和运行。调试按钮:进入调试模式。构建按钮:构建所选项目。构建套件选择器4.定位器及输出窗口定位器输出窗口定位器:快速查找项目、文件、类和方法等。输出窗口:包含“问题”、“SearchResults”、“应用程序输出”、“编译输出”、“DebuggerConsole”和“概要信息”8个选项。Qt的选项配置

在Kits选项下可以配置构建套件,单击任一套件名即可展开详细的配置信息,从而进行配置。在“环境”选项下可以配置用户界面的颜色、主题和语言等。在“文本编辑器”选项下可根据喜好配置代码的字体、字号和颜色。为了代码的整齐性,还可以配置制表符策略、制表符尺寸和缩进尺寸。第一个Qt项目新建HelloWorld项目项目文件介绍设置应用程序图标运行发布发布程序本章任务

安装Qt并配置开发环境,新建一个HelloWorld项目,并将HelloWorld的应用程序图标设置为自己喜欢

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论